Why escape rooms are a great fit for kids and teens

Escape rooms are thrilling adventures that challenge the mind and foster teamwork. 

Whether it's deciphering clues, collaborating on solutions, or celebrating a mission accomplished, players find themselves immersed in a world of mystery and excitement.


For kids and teens, escape games offer a unique blend of education and entertainment, making learning fun and interactive.

We offer child-friendly versions of The Prison and The Bunker

Understanding that younger minds might need a different kind of challenge, we can adapt this escape room mission for our young adventurers. 

We add extra hints and clues that are age-appropriate. 

Each room comes with a dedicated Game Master, always on the lookout, ensuring that the young players are on the right track. 

While we encourage the kids to explore clues and collaborate as a team, our Game Master is always ready to provide hints to ensure the game remains engaging and progresses smoothly.

See below for adult supervision requirements based on age.

Age requirements for Child-Friendly rooms

Our escape rooms are crafted to be enjoyable for those aged 10 and above. 

However, we've noticed that 12-year-olds often have the most exhilarating experience.

 

For kids ages 10-12, we do require that at least 1 parent or guardian join in The Bunker and at least 2 parents or guardians in The Prison. They are welcome to be either an active participant or an observer.

For kids ages 13-14, while they can enjoy the game independently, a parent or guardian must stay nearby in our lobby during the entirety of their game

*The child-friendly version of these games is not recommended for a group of kids ages 9 and under. If you are looking for a game more appropriate for this age group, please contact our box office for recommendations of other escape rooms in the area better suited for them.
